As of now, the Kings are in a precarious 3rd spot in the Pacific Division. They are 2 games ahead of Nashville and Dallas, but one point behind Nashville, and tied with Dallas for 86 points. Vegas has a game in hand, and is only 2 points behind. A win for them, and a loss for the Kings would put Vegas back into contention, and knock L.A. right out. So, to say this is a must-win for the California team would be a massive understatement. They will, however, have to win it without Drew Doughty, who just underwent successful wrist surgery, and will be out for the remainder of the season.
The Hawks and Kings have only met once before, this year, and Chicago came away with a 4-3 S/O win. Colin Delia was in net for that game, too.
